自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(4)
  • 资源 (10)
  • 问答 (1)
  • 收藏
  • 关注

原创 中介者模式

1.中介者模式的定义 中介者模式包装了一系列对象相互作用的方式,是的这些对象不必相互明显作用。从而使它们可以松散耦合。当某些对象之间的作用发生变化时,不会立即影响其它的一些对象之间的作用。保证这些作用可以彼此独立的变化。中介者模式将多对多的相互作用转化为一对多的相互作用。终结者模式将对象的行为和写作抽象化,把对象在小尺度的行为上与其他对象的相互作用分开处理。 2.中介者模式的使用场景 当对象...

2018-10-21 18:03:55 292

原创 访问者模式

1.访问者模式介绍 访问者模式的基本想法是,软件系统中拥有一个有许多对象构成的、比较稳定的对象结构,这些对象的累都拥有一个accept方法用来接受访问者对象的访问。访问者是一个接口,它拥有一个visit方法,这个方法对方问到的对象结构中不同类型的元素作出不同的处理。在对象结构的一次访问过程中,我们遍历整个对象结构,对每一个元素都实施accept方法,在每一个元素的accept方法中会调用访问者的...

2018-10-18 19:55:25 143

原创 模板方法模式

1.模板方法模式介紹 在面向对象开发过程中,通常会遇到这样的一个问题,我们知道一个算法所需要的关键步骤,并且确定了这些步骤的执行顺序,但是,某些步骤的具体实现是未知的,或者说某些步骤地实现是会随着环境的变化而改变的,例如,执行程序的流程大致如下: 检查代码的正确性; 链接相关的类库; 编译相关代码; 执行程序; 对于不同的程序设计语言,上述4个步骤都是不一样的,但是,他们的执行流程是固定...

2018-10-17 16:08:18 155

原创 onSaveInstanceState调用时机

当某个Activity变得容易被系统销毁时,该Activity的onSaveInstanceState函数就会被执行,除非该Activity是被用户主动销毁的,如当用户按back键时。 意思是说,该Activity还没又被销毁,而仅仅是一种可能性,这种可能性有这么几种情况: 1.当用户按下Home键时; 2.长按Home键,选择运行其他的程序时; 3.按下电源键(关闭屏幕显示)时; 4....

2018-10-15 19:35:32 1738

api-ms-win-crt-private-l1-1-0.zip

api-ms-win-crt-private-l1-1-0.dll 下载后解压复制该文件到命令执行目录即可

2020-11-07

设计模式demo

设计模式domo代码,https://blog.csdn.net/xyzso1z/article/category/8232526

2019-02-28

WebView与Android交互

webView与Android交互的几种方式讲解

2018-12-01

中介者模式

中介者模式 《Android源码设计模式解析与实战》金合欢花或或

2018-10-21

访问者模式

https://blog.csdn.net/xyzso1z/article/details/83115710文章地址

2018-10-18

模板方法Demo

模板方法Demo ,取自《Android源码设计模式解析与实战 15章》

2018-10-17

EasyX_2014冬至版

头文件graphics.h,可以用画图

2017-06-24

java语言模拟数据库增删查改排序(源代码+课程报告)

数据库中有“表”的概念。“表”由若干“行”组成,每“行”由许多“列”组成。一般的数据库都提供了对SQL的支持。 我们可以模拟一个最简单版的SQL,只能实现简单的排序,简单的选择条件,列的显示顺序等功能。

2017-06-24

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除